What affects the price

When you talk to a lawyer about a car accident, costs aren't one-size-fits-all. The final amount depends on several moving parts, like how complex your injuries are, the amount of evidence we need to gather, and whether the insurance company decides to fight back or settle early. Sometimes a case requires hiring accident reconstruction experts or medical specialists, which adds to the work involved. While some cases stay simple, others demand months of negotiation.
